Product Description
The Venera model stands on four legs as a dining or High table, perfectly suited to the popular French bistro look. The frame is crafted from black cast steel. The model is compatible with round tabletops with a diameter of 50 to 80 cm and with square tabletops from 50 x 50 cm to 80 x 80 cm.- Four-leg construction - panels up to 80x80cm
- Easy-care and rust-free thanks to the powder-coated surface
- Extremely robust thanks to heavy cast steel

Material
Tabletop Ercus A
The Ercus A solid oak tabletop with a thickness of 28 mm has a robust and rustic appearance. The rounded corners give it a harmonious look, while the natural, transparent lacquered surface stylishly highlights the natural grain of the wood.
